Solution

The correct option is C Peduncle
  • The stalk holding the complete inflorescence and bearing the flowers or fruit, in a flowering plant is known as the peduncle.
  • The pedicle is the stem that attaches a single flower.
  • The petiole is the stalk that attaches a leaf to the stem and the leaflet of a pinnately compound leaf is called pinna.
So, the correct option is 'Peduncle'.
